SoftBank Investment Advisers

SoftBank Investment Advisers is a venture capital firm established in 2017 and headquartered in London, United Kingdom. It operates as a subsidiary of SoftBank Group Corp. and specializes in growth capital and late-stage investments predominantly within the technology sector. The firm focuses on a diverse array of industries, including internet-of-things, artificial intelligence, robotics, telecommunications, computational biology, fintech, and digital financial services. With a preference for global investments, particularly in the United States, SoftBank Investment Advisers typically commits a minimum of $100 million to both minority and majority stakes in private and public companies. The firm is known for offering operational expertise and leveraging a vast global network, aiming to support innovative companies that have the potential to revolutionize their respective fields. It maintains additional offices in key locations such as Tokyo, San Francisco, and Singapore.

Past deals in Florida

Mean DAO

Seed Round in 2021
Mean DAO operates as a decentralized autonomous organization focused on treasury management and payment automation. It develops and funds the Mean Protocol, which consists of a set of interoperable smart contracts designed to streamline banking workflows and investment operations. The platform features a real-time payment streaming protocol and a user-friendly dashboard, allowing application developers to implement flexible payment schedules effectively. By automating payment and banking processes, Mean DAO aims to enhance efficiency and accessibility in financial transactions.

Papa

Series D in 2021
Papa is a platform that connects college students to senior citizens for companionship and assistance. The platform connects college and nursing students to older adults who need assistance with transportation, house chores, technology lessons, and other services that enable older adults to stay independent while living securely and happily at home. Papa was founded in 2018 and is headquartered in Miami, Florida.

QuickNode

Seed Round in 2021
QuickNode is a comprehensive blockchain development platform. Its fast, reliable APIs, time-saving tools, and customer support enable developers & businesses to execute their Web3 ideas and strategies. Founded in Miami in 2017.

Lumu

Seed Round in 2021
Lumu is a cybersecurity company that helps enterprises identify and isolate cyber-compromise in real-time. Lumu illuminates threats, attacks, and adversaries affecting enterprises. Lumu secures networks by enhancing and augmenting existing defense capabilities, using actionable intelligence. Utilizing principles of Continuous Compromise Assessment, Lumu creates a closed-loop, self-learning solution that helps security teams accelerate compromise detection, gain real-time visibility across their infrastructure, and close the breach detection gap from months to minutes. Lumu was founded in 2019 and is headquartered in Doral, Florida.

REEF

Private Equity Round in 2020
REEF is a network of mobility and urban logistics hubs in North America, consisting of 4,500 locations and a workforce of 15,000 associates across 200 cities. The company focuses on transforming underutilized urban spaces into neighborhood hubs that cater to the needs of cities, residents, and businesses. By leveraging technology, REEF provides solutions for parking, micro-fulfillment, and delivery that reduce congestion and support environmentally friendly practices. Each hub functions as a connected ecosystem that enhances the efficiency of goods and services delivery in densely populated areas. REEF's strategic design incorporates buffer zones, which allow delivery and rideshare vehicles to operate effectively, thereby alleviating city traffic. The organization aims to redefine urban possibilities and create vibrant community hubs that foster sustainable growth.

Splyt

Series B in 2020
Splyt is a B2B mobility marketplace that connects institutional supply and demand for ground-based transport. It makes mobility inventory available through its single API, without the users of its demand-side partners needing to download or register with additional suppliers. The company was founded in 2015 and is headquartered in London, England.

5x5 Technologies

Series A in 2018
5x5 Technologies Inc. specializes in developing unmanned aircraft systems and advanced data analytics solutions for critical infrastructure owners. Founded in 2016 and based in St. Petersburg, Florida, the company provides a software-as-a-service platform that utilizes artificial intelligence and machine learning to create accurate digital twin models of complex structures. This technology enables clients to optimize performance, automate workflows, and reduce operational costs while uncovering new revenue opportunities through enhanced portfolio-wide analytics. Trusted by leading companies, systems integrators, and governmental agencies, 5x5 Technologies combines 3D analytics with innovative system integrations, positioning itself as a leader in the unmanned aerial vehicle and data analytics sectors. The firm has a global workforce with employees across North and Central America, Europe, and Asia, and is supported by various investors, including Softbank Corp. and several innovation-driven family offices.
